RPA accepting submissions for 4th-annual “Excellence in Reusable Packaging Award”

The award recognizes companies that have developed, supported, or implemented measurable and innovative reusable solutions in a business-to-business supply chain.


The Reusable Packaging Association is accepting submissions for its fourth annual Excellence in Reusable Packaging Award. The award recognizes companies that have developed, supported, or implemented measurable and innovative reusable solutions in a business-to-business supply chain. Non-members as well as members of the RPA are encouraged to enter.

“Winning the award gives companies recognition for their hard work in achieving cost and environmental savings with reusables,” said Jerry Welcome, President of the RPA. “And the program gives more visibility to the tangible results delivered by reusables.”

Businesses of all sizes are encouraged to enter. Two awards are given: one for businesses with revenues less than $25 million, and one for businesses with revenues more than $25 million. The submission form is available on the RPA website reusables.org

Submissions will be reviewed by an independent committee of judges who are not members of the RPA. The judges are: Diana Twede, Ph.D. Professor, Michigan State University; Justin Lehrer, Program Manager, StopWaste.org; Ben Miyares, President, Packaging Management Institute; and Rick LeBlanc, Editor, Packaging Revolution.

The deadline for submissions is June 12, 2015. Eligible companies must have participated in the reusable packaging industry as of September 1, 2014. Companies will be judged on the quantifiable environmental and economic benefits of their reusable packaging solutions and services. Each end-user company that completes a submission will receive a free one-year membership to the Reusable Packaging Association.

Past winners are Svenska Retursystem and Full Belly Farm (2014); Finelite (2013); and Herman Miller Inc. (2012). The award is supported by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), Reusable Packaging Machinery Institute (PMMI) and StopWaste.Org.
